Chilton County Commission approves routine consent items, library and DHR appointments

Chilton County Commission · November 26, 2025

The commission unanimously approved the consent agenda including personnel hires and contracts, closed nominations and appointed Miss Mitchell to the Chilton-Clanton Library Board and Stanley Barnard to the Department of Human Resources board, and approved routine procurement and staffing items.

The Chilton County Commission unanimously approved its consent agenda and several board appointments at the Nov. 25 meeting.

Consent agenda items approved included minutes (Nov. 13), claims lists (Nov. 25), a sheriff’s resolution to hire part-time deputy Rocky Mims, an Alabama Power easement with signature authority for the chair and administrator, acceptance of quotes for road-department work, a transit appraisal contract with M Reagan Real Property Services LLC for $2,950 for a proposed new transit location (old tag office), approval of advertisement placements on public transportation buses, removal of Calvin Smitherman from the Park and Recreation payroll, hiring Tara Green as a full-time animal control specialist, and a resolution to advertise for financing quotes for eight new dump trucks for the road department.

Appointments: The commission closed nominations and, as requested by the library board, unanimously appointed Miss Mitchell to the Chilton-Clanton Library Board. For the Department of Human Resources (DHR) board, the commission closed nominations and appointed Stanley Barnard unanimously.

What’s next: These are routine governance and personnel actions; contract signatures and administrative follow-up will complete the listed procurements and appointments. No dissent or abstentions were recorded in the transcript.
